For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 624 students in Wheatland J1 School District. This district's average testing ranking is 7/10, which is in the top 50% of public schools in Wisconsin.
Public School in Wheatland J1 School District have an average math proficiency score of 47% (versus the Wisconsin public school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 40% (versus the 38%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 7%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Wisconsin public school average of 34% (majority Hispanic and Black).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$15,313 in this school district is less than the state median of $17,045. The school district revenue/student has declined by 6%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$13,713 is less than the state median of $17,017. The school district spending/student has declined by 40% over four school years.
